School districts are mandated to locate, evaluate, and identify students who need special education and related services. If your child struggles in school, they may be eligible for an individual education plan (IEP). However, the school district must first evaluate them to determine if they meet the criteria for eligibility for an IEP before creating and implementing an IEP. The scope of the evaluation is to determine if they are eligible and what services and supports they need to receive a free appropriate public education.
